Role Description

Bamboo Health Security designs forward-thinking security solutions across cloud services, identity and access management, virtualization, and third-party integrations. We focus on innovative, scalable practices that meet complex regulatory requirements and support the company’s growth. Our team is highly collaborative and committed to both business success and individual development.

We are seeking a Senior Governance, Risk and Compliance (GRC) Analyst to help mature our compliance program, contribute to our audit cycles, and serve as the security interface for our customers. You will:

  • Evaluate organizational policies and standards, ensuring that external and internal compliance requirements are met.
  • Develop improvements to the compliance program, including the use of AI, automation, and process optimization.
  • Review security-relevant language in customer contracts (MSAs, DPAs, BAAs) and RFP/RFI security sections, providing recommendations to Legal and the broader GRC team.
  • Respond to customer security questionnaires using AI-assisted tools and trust content, exercising professional judgment to ensure responses are accurate and complete.
  • Work with external auditors and customers as necessary, providing them with required information and assistance.
  • Maintain and update trust center content and customer-facing security documentation.
  • Perform vendor security risk assessments and contribute to the third-party risk management program.
  • Assist in policy documentation upkeep and development, ensuring clarity and applicability.
  • Monitor and assist with the internal training programs on compliance requirements and best practices.
  • Ensure Bamboo Health’s security operations remain aligned with both internal and external compliance requirements, contributing to ongoing internal and external audit reviews.
  • Effectively communicate Bamboo Health’s compliance posture to both internal and external stakeholders, offering tangible proof of adherence to policy requirements.
  • Partner with the larger Information Security team to identify areas for continuous improvement within the compliance framework.
  • Stay curious about emerging AI tools and how they can streamline or enhance work within your function.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in information security, computer science, or related field, or equivalent experience in a related field.
  • Security compliance-related certifications such as CISSP, CISA, or CRISC are preferred.
  • 5+ years of experience in information security, with substantial focus on compliance, audit, or risk management work.
  • Direct experience with security frameworks and certifications like NIST SP 800-53, HITRUST, HIPAA, and/or FedRAMP.
  • Experience responding to customer security questionnaires and supporting customer security due diligence activities.
  • Experience reviewing security-relevant language in customer or vendor contracts.
  • Familiarity with healthcare data protection requirements (HIPAA) and the compliance obligations they create.
  • Demonstrated experience with security auditing and evidence gathering for compliance purposes.
  • Experience evaluating security controls for compliance purposes.
  • Familiarity with cloud security concepts and practices.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with ability to build and communicate business rationale.
  • Strong ability to learn quickly and work independently while being part of a team.
  • Ability to build effective, sustainable working relationships internally, with customers, and external stakeholders.
  • Comfort using or learning AI-supported tools (e.g., ChatGPT, CoPilot, or role-specific tools) to improve daily workflows.
  • A forward-thinking, curious mindset with an openness to experimenting with new technologies.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with sound judgment and creativity in designing solutions.
  • Proven ability to thrive in fast-paced, high-growth, and rapidly evolving environments.
  • Ability to work effectively in a remote-first environment, ensuring high-quality virtual interactions with minimal distractions.

Requirements

  • In 3 months: Understand and be able to describe Bamboo Health's products, organizational structure, customer base, and compliance landscape (SOC 2, HITRUST, FedRAMP, etc.).
  • Develop familiarity with policies, risk register, and trust center content.
  • Independently respond to customer security questionnaires using established trust content and AI-assisted tools.
  • Independently perform vendor security reviews.
  • Build partnership with InfoSec team, Legal, Sales, and key cross-functional partners.
  • Incorporate AI-supported tools into your day-to-day work—whether through analysis, documentation, or task management.
  • In 6 months: Actively contribute to audit cycles, including evidence collection and control mapping.
  • Own recurring compliance tasks (e.g., periodic access reviews, policy reviews, evidence collection cycles).
  • Review security-relevant contract language and RFP security sections, providing actionable recommendations.
  • Identify compliance gaps and recommend remediation approaches.
  • Produce routine metrics and reporting on assigned work streams.
  • Support the team's efforts with educational security initiatives and objectives.
  • In 12 months: Independently lead customer security trust activities — questionnaires, trust content, and customer security review calls.
  • Own specific compliance frameworks or domains with minimal oversight.
  • Drive improvements to the GRC program, including expanded use of AI and automation.
  • Contribute meaningfully to audit cycle outcomes, including evidence quality and finding remediation.
  • Serve as a trusted subject matter expert and mentor within the Information Security team.
